Crowd Analytics Market Analysis Reveals Shifting Strategic Priorities
The Crowd Analytics Market Analysis reveals a sector at a strategic pivot, where the primary drivers for adoption are shifting from simple crowd counting to comprehensive intelligence for operational optimization and public safety. A core finding is the growing recognition of crowd analytics as an essential tool for data-driven decision-making across diverse sectors [citation:provided text]. The analysis shows that organizations are increasingly prioritizing real-time insights, with the real-time analytics segment projected to grow significantly [citation:provided text]. A survey found that approximately 85% of decision-makers consider security a top priority when selecting crowd analytics solutions [citation:provided text]. The demand for understanding crowd behavior and movement patterns is driving investment across retail, transportation, event management, and smart city applications .
A critical finding is the dominant role of the retail segment, which commands the largest application share due to the need for customer insights and operational optimization [citation:provided text]. Retailers leverage crowd analytics to monitor consumer behavior, optimize store layouts, and enhance customer experiences [citation:provided text]. The Smart Cities application is the fastest-growing segment, projected to expand from USD 2.2 billion in 2024 to USD 16.8 billion by 2035, as urban planners deploy crowd data to improve traffic flows, public safety, and sustainable infrastructure planning [citation:provided text]. The commercial sector dominates the end-use segment, while the government sector is emerging as the fastest-growing segment, driven by investments in urban planning and public safety [citation:provided text]. The healthcare sector is projected to see significant growth as hospitals and clinics leverage crowd analytics for patient flow optimization [citation:provided text].
The analysis also highlights the intensifying focus on privacy and security, which is reshaping product development and deployment strategies [citation:provided text]. As crowd analytics relies heavily on data collection, there is a growing emphasis on ensuring privacy and security [citation:provided text]. Organizations are adopting measures to protect individual data while still gaining valuable insights from crowd behavior [citation:provided text]. Regulatory compliance with frameworks like GDPR and the EU AI Act is becoming a key differentiator . The need for balancing data utility with privacy concerns is driving innovation in anonymization and differential privacy technologies . The market analysis indicates that vendors who can demonstrate robust privacy protections will have a significant competitive advantage.
